У меня есть клиент, у которого на сервере установлены две версии Tomcat. Один Tomcat устанавливается из RHEL yum, а другой - в / usr / local. Цель состоит в том, чтобы по возможности всегда использовать пакеты из yum, чтобы придерживаться стандартной конфигурации на нескольких машинах в группе. Я уже скопировал / usr / local / tomcat / webapps / * в / var / lib / tomcat6 / webapps, и Tomcat запускается без жалоб. Однако в / home также есть каталоги webapp / ROOT, принадлежащие различным пользователям.
Есть ли в системе Red Hat список файлов конфигурации, которые я должен отредактировать, чтобы предотвратить использование двоичных файлов / usr / local / tomcat?
Спасибо.
Я не уверен, что вы имеете в виду под «предотвращением использования двоичных файлов / usr / local / tomcat». Если вы запустите сервер приложений с помощью предоставленных сценариев запуска RedHat в /etc/init.d/tomcat6, вы будете использовать сервер приложений / usr / share / tomcat6.
Если вы хотите перечислить файлы конфигурации, установленные RPM tomcat6, вы можете сделать это:
rpm -qlc tomcat6